We base our rankings on the following scoring system: For skill-position players, one point for every 10 rushing/receiving yards, one point for every 30 passing yards, six points for a TD run or catch, four points for a TD pass, two points for a two-point conversion run or catch, two points for a two-point conversion pass. For kickers, three points for FGs of 18-39 yards, four points for FGs of 40-49 yards, and five points for FGs of 50-plus yards. Defensive rankings are based primarily on points allowed, yardage allowed and sack potential.
Glossary of notations
INJ — player has an injury that may affect productivity or availability.
ILL — player has an illness that may affect productivity or availability.
UP — player was moved up on draft board after original posting.
DOWN — player was moved down on draft board after original posting.
Not listed — player is temporarily sidelined due to injury or suspension but otherwise would be ranked.
ACTIVE — on game day, player has been designated active (posted shortly before kickoff, when available).
INACTIVE — on game day, player has been designated inactive (posted shortly before kickoff, when available).
Players and/or notations added after the original posting are shown in boldface.
